Julie Dunn is a scholar working on Emergency Medicine, Surgery and Neurology. According to data from OpenAlex, Julie Dunn has authored 53 papers receiving a total of 742 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Emergency Medicine, 14 papers in Surgery and 13 papers in Neurology. Recurrent topics in Julie Dunn’s work include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(13 papers), Long-Term Effects of COVID-19 (7 papers) and Traumatic Brain Injury and Neurovascular Disturbances (6 papers). Julie Dunn is often cited by papers focused on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(13 papers), Long-Term Effects of COVID-19 (7 papers) and Traumatic Brain Injury and Neurovascular Disturbances (6 papers). Julie Dunn coll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and South Africa. Julie Dunn's co-authors include M. Anderson, Michael D. Williams, Sachchida N. Sinha, Susan S. Huang, Vichien Lorch, J. A. C. Buckels, Bridget Gunson, Giuseppe Tisone, Mark Deakin and Jane Warwick and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Immunology, Gastroenterology and British Journal of Cancer.
